Section of carbonate-cemented shells in Estonian phosphorites, from the Toolse deposit, Lääne-Virumaa district.

Shells are mineralised in CAF-apatite. Those most altered by diagenesis acquire a dark colour and are covered with micro-pyrites, mostly on the laminae that previously held organic matter.
